Why Postpartum Care Matters
The care a mother receives in the weeks and months after birth matters. Rest, nourishment, and support during postpartum shape how a woman recovers, how she feels in her body, and how she moves forward into motherhood.
Many traditions teach that the first 40 days after birth set the foundation for the next 40 years. This is a time for healing, replenishment, and being cared for—not rushing or doing it all alone. I’m here to support you as you rest, recover, and find your footing in this new season.

Pink Flamingo Postpartum Care & Wellbeing was named after the mother flamingo, who often loses her pink colour after giving birth. With time and nourishment, her vibrant colour returns.
In the same way, my work is about caring for you—so you can feel replenished, grounded, and supported to regain your vibrancy as you move through the early months of motherhood.
